I have a few thoughts about the ending, and why I don't think it's Jamie, Market Equities (ME), or Rainwater.
First let's talk Jamie, I don't think it's him for several reasons, one of which is time, I don't think he had time to plan it out, and the other is it's messy and not really thought out. Let's take each hit individually.
John - It was sloppy, a couple of rednecks in a van, and I think Jamie want's John to suffer by seeing him (Jamie) take everything, or at least cause the downfall of the ranch.
Beth - while I can believe he'd kill Beth, Jamie is smart enough to know that if he did, he'd have to kill Rip too (same with John)
Kayce - I just can't see Jamie killing Kayce at all, plus again it seems messy, a shootout in a commissioner's office? I can't see it.
I don't think it was Roarke or ME either, I have no doubt that they'd kill all of the Dutton, but it's too messy and disorganized, it they did it, they'd get professionals to do it and make sure it was done right. A bombing in town, and a shoot out in a public official's office would be really bad PR and end up hurting them more than helping. It's all too public and messy. Also, as far as ME is concerned, John is the only holdup, they heard Jamie in the meeting saying he would authorize the sale, and Roarke had the conversation with Beth about what would happen, not only did she agree with him, she had the same conversation with John. So they'd really only need to take John out, then the kids would sell.
I don't believe it was Rainwater either, for many of the same reasons, it's too messy and disorganized, not enough time after the conversation with Blue Thunder, plus IF he did it, he'd probably put Mo in charge, and he'd do it right. Plus, ME is still his immediate and biggest problem, he’d still have to fight them for the land.
I think if it was done by one group or a person, it is probably the white supremacist militia from S2 that took Tate and then had a bunch get killed or jailed by the Duttons.
It's also possible that each is separate and a coincidence that they happened at the same time.
John - I don't think it was Jamie, but it could have been his biological father, you don't bring in a actor like Will Patton for just a couple of lines like the last episodes, he definitely has a bigger part coming up.
Beth - maybe someone she's screwed over while having her company buy all that land, or the box could have been there a while and is a leftover from the Becks or something along those lines.
Kayce - Could be the family of the cattle thief he killed earlier, or again the white supremacist guys.
